Step 11: Complete the Head Enclosure
Attach the camera and Raspberry Pi assembly to the head base, route its power and Ethernet cables to the RPU, and install the three head covers.
Parts needed
| Part | Count |
|---|---|
| Integrated assembly from Step 9 | 1 |
| Camera and Raspberry Pi assembly from Step 10 | 1 |
| top head cover | 1 |
| left head cover | 1 |
| right head cover | 1 |
| M4x14 socket bolts | 4 |
| M4x10 flat bolts | 10 |
| Raspberry Pi power cable | 1 |
| Ethernet cable | 1 |
| Threadlocker | As needed |
Instructions
Align Sub Assembly from Step 10 with the 4 threaded hole on part . Take 4 - M4x14 socket bolts and lightly tighten into the 4 threaded holes at each corner of part .
After the parts are aligned:
- remove each of the 4 – M4x14 socket bolts in a star formation,
- apply threadlocker,
- then tighten them back to secure Part and part together.
Route the Raspberry Pi power and Ethernet cables through part and the neck cutout, then connect each cable's connector to its specified RPU port.
Take part and slide it on top of the RPI and align with part .
Take part and fit it to the left side of the head.
Take 5 - M4x10 flat bolts and lightly tighten into the 5 holes on part to align with the head. Once aligned, tighten all 5 - M4x10 flat bolts to secure the part together.
Take part and fit it to the right side of the head.
Take 5 - M4x10 flat bolts and lightly tighten into the 5 holes on part to align with the head. Once aligned, tighten all 5 - M4x10 flat bolts to secure the part together.
